在线YAML——打造高效的配置文件管理

一、什么是在线YAML

YAML(”YAML Ain’t Markup Language”)是一种人类可读的数据序列化语言,用于编写配置文件、数据传输格式、日志文件等多种应用场景。在线YAML是一种可在线编辑、存储、分享、导入导出YAML文件的在线工具,拥有着配置文件高效管理的优越性能。

在使用在线YAML时,用户只需在编辑器中输入或上传YAML文件,即可实现在线编辑和修改,同时还可以方便地导入导出文件,分享文件链接,以及支持多用户实时协作编辑。此外,该在线工具还具有高效的代码高亮、语法提示、错误提示等功能,使得YAML文件的编写和管理变得更加便捷和高效。


# 示例YAML文件

person:
  name: John 
  age: 30 
  gender: Male 
  hobbies: 
    - Reading 
    - Swimming 

二、在线YAML的特点

1、在线编辑

在线YAML支持在线编辑YAML文件,用户只需在编辑器中进行输入和修改操作即可,无需下载或安装本地软件。此外,在线编辑还支持自动保存和版本控制,可以方便地进行文件的版本回滚和历史记录查看。

2、多平台支持

在线YAML支持多平台使用,包括Windows、Linux、Mac OS等各种操作系统,同时兼容多种浏览器,如Chrome、Firefox、Safari等。用户可以随时随地登录到在线YAML,并进行文件的管理和编辑。

3、文件导入导出

在线YAML支持文件的导入导出功能,用户可以方便地将本地的YAML文件上传至在线平台或者将在线平台的YAML文件导出至本地。此外,该工具还支持从其他平台的文件中进行导入,如GitHub、GitLab等。

4、多用户协作

在线YAML支持多用户协作编辑,多个用户可以共同编辑同一个YAML文件。同时,该工具还支持实时协作,用户可以即时查看他人的修改和编辑操作,保证文件的正确性和及时性。

三、在线YAML的应用场景

1、配置文件管理

YAML作为一种常用的配置文件格式,被广泛应用于各种Web应用服务的配置文件中,如Django配置文件、Spring Boot配置文件、Docker Compose配置文件等。在线YAML可以提供高效的配置文件管理功能,使得多个开发者可以方便地编辑、管理和分享配置文件。

2、数据传输格式

YAML也常被作为一种常用的数据序列化格式,用于Web API的数据传输和交互。在线YAML可以提供高效的数据格式转换和管理功能,开发者可以方便地将YAML文件转换为其他格式,如JSON、XML等。

3、日志文件记录

在线YAML也可以被用于日志文件的记录和管理,开发者可以将日志信息记录为YAML文件的格式,方便进行日志数据的归档和管理。在线YAML可以提供高效的日志文件查看和管理功能,开发者可以方便地查看、编辑和分享日志文件。

四、总结

在线YAML是一种高效的配置文件管理工具,具有在线编辑、多平台支持、文件导入导出、多用户协作等优秀特点,被广泛应用于各种Web应用服务的配置文件管理、数据传输格式、日志文件记录等场景中。用户可以通过在线YAML实现YAML文件的高效管理和协作,提高开发效率和文件管理的便捷性。

原创文章,作者:小蓝,如若转载,请注明出处:https://www.506064.com/n/254902.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
小蓝小蓝
上一篇 2024-12-15 12:13
下一篇 2024-12-15 12:13

相关推荐

  • Trocket:打造高效可靠的远程控制工具

    如何使用trocket打造高效可靠的远程控制工具?本文将从以下几个方面进行详细的阐述。 一、安装和使用trocket trocket是一个基于Python实现的远程控制工具,使用时…

    编程 2025-04-28
  • Python在线编辑器的优势与实现方式

    Python在线编辑器是Python语言爱好者的重要工具之一,它可以让用户方便快捷的在线编码、调试和分享代码,无需在本地安装Python环境。本文将从多个方面对Python在线编辑…

    编程 2025-04-28
  • Python生成列表最高效的方法

    本文主要介绍在Python中生成列表最高效的方法,涉及到列表生成式、range函数、map函数以及ITertools模块等多种方法。 一、列表生成式 列表生成式是Python中最常…

    编程 2025-04-28
  • TFN MR56:高效可靠的网络环境管理工具

    本文将从多个方面深入阐述TFN MR56的作用、特点、使用方法以及优点,为读者全面介绍这一高效可靠的网络环境管理工具。 一、简介 TFN MR56是一款多功能的网络环境管理工具,可…

    编程 2025-04-27
  • 用Pythonic的方式编写高效代码

    Pythonic是一种编程哲学,它强调Python编程风格的简单、清晰、优雅和明确。Python应该描述为一种语言而不是一种编程语言。Pythonic的编程方式不仅可以使我们在编码…

    编程 2025-04-27
  • 基于标签文件管理

    本文将从文件管理的角度出发,深入探讨基于标签的文件管理。 一、标签文件管理简介 标签文件管理即通过给文件打上标签来进行分类和管理的方式。与传统文件管理相比,标签文件管理更加灵活方便…

    编程 2025-04-27
  • CentOS 7在线安装MySQL 8

    在本文中,我们将介绍如何在CentOS 7操作系统中在线安装MySQL 8。我们会从安装环境的准备开始,到安装MySQL 8的过程进行详细的阐述。 一、环境准备 在进行MySQL …

    编程 2025-04-27
  • Python生成10万条数据的高效方法

    本文将从以下几个方面探讨如何高效地生成Python中的10万条数据: 一、使用Python内置函数生成数据 Python提供了许多内置函数可以用来生成数据,例如range()函数可…

    编程 2025-04-27
  • Gino FastAPI实现高效低耗ORM

    本文将从以下多个方面详细阐述Gino FastAPI的优点与使用,展现其实现高效低耗ORM的能力。 一、快速入门 首先,我们需要在项目中安装Gino FastAPI: pip in…

    编程 2025-04-27
  • 如何利用字节跳动推广渠道高效推广产品

    对于企业或者个人而言,推广产品或者服务是必须的。如何让更多的人知道、认识、使用你的产品是推广的核心问题。而今天,我们要为大家介绍的是如何利用字节跳动推广渠道高效推广产品。 一、个性…

    编程 2025-04-27

发表回复

登录后才能评论